THE PHONEME AS A BASIC-LEVEL CATEGORY: EXPERIMENTAL EVIDENCE FROM ENGLISH

This paper presents the results of a concept formation experiment that provides evidence on the possible existence of a basic-level of taxonomic organization in phonological categories as conceived of by phonetically naïve, native speakers of English. This level is roughly equivalent to the phoneme...
